What it means

The meaning of Karim Nader

“Karim Nader is an Arabic boy name often understood as “generous and rare.” Karim means “generous,” “noble,” or “honorable,” while Nader means “rare” or “precious.””

Karim Nader has a beautifully balanced meaning for a boy: generous and rare. Karim comes from Arabic كريم, a name and word associated with generosity, nobility, honor, and open-heartedness. It has a warm, dignified sound without feeling heavy. Parents often like that Karim feels kind first. It suggests someone who gives freely, treats people well, and carries himself with grace. Nader comes from Arabic نادر, usually understood as “rare,” “uncommon,” or “precious.” As a second name, it adds a lovely sense of distinction. Karim Nader can feel like a quiet blessing: a generous person who is also one of a kind. It is not flashy. It has a thoughtful, scholarly tone, the kind of name that works on a child, a teen, and a grown man signing his name with confidence. Both names are widely recognizable in Arabic-speaking families and Muslim communities, though they are also used culturally by Arabic-speaking Christians and others. Karim is especially familiar because it is tied to the admired quality of generosity. In Islamic culture, Al-Karim is one of the names or attributes used for God, meaning “The Generous” or “The Noble,” so many families hear the name with an added layer of reverence and beauty. As a personal name, Karim is used to reflect that valued human trait, not to claim divinity. Nader is a little more distinctive in feel. It gives the full name a softer ending and a memorable rhythm: ka-REEM NA-der. Together, Karim Nader feels polished, international, and deeply rooted in Arabic language. It is easy enough for English speakers to learn, but it still keeps its original character. For parents who want a name with kindness, rarity, and cultural depth, Karim Nader is a strong choice.

Heritage

Cultural & religious significance

Karim Nader sits comfortably in Arabic naming tradition because both parts are meaningful words as well as personal names. Karim carries a strong moral feeling. In many Arabic-speaking families, generosity is more than being polite. It can mean feeding guests before yourself, helping relatives quietly, and treating strangers with dignity. A boy named Karim may hear his name used in everyday speech as a reminder of kindness and honor. There is also a religious layer for many Muslim families. Al-Karim is known as a divine attribute meaning “The Generous” or “The Noble.” Because of that, Karim can feel spiritually rich while still being very usable as a given name. Families often choose names like this because they point toward a virtue they hope a child will grow into. The name is not treated casually in every household, but it is familiar and warmly accepted. Nader adds the idea of rarity. In Arabic, calling something nader can suggest that it is uncommon, special, or hard to find. As a name, it does not sound showy. It feels thoughtful. Paired with Karim, it gives a child a full name that says, in plain language, “generous and rare.” There are no broad taboos around using Karim Nader as a boy’s name. The main practical point is pronunciation. Some families say Nader closer to NAH-der, while others use NAY-der in English-speaking settings. Either can happen in daily life, so parents may want to choose the version they prefer and model it gently.

Frequently asked questions about Karim Nader

What does the name Karim Nader mean?
Karim Nader is usually understood as “generous and rare.” Karim means generous, noble, or honorable, while Nader means rare, uncommon, or precious.
Is Karim Nader a boy or girl name?
Karim Nader is traditionally used as a boy name in Arabic. Karim is a masculine given name, and Nader is also commonly used for boys.
How do you pronounce Karim Nader?
A clear pronunciation is ka-REEM NAH-der. In IPA, it can be written /kaˈriːm ˈnaːdir/, though pronunciation may shift a little by family, dialect, or country.
